How robust firmware signing and verification chains prevent unauthorized code execution on semiconductor platforms.
A comprehensive exploration of firmware signing and verification chains, describing how layered cryptographic protections, trusted boot processes, and supply chain safeguards collaborate to prevent rogue code from running on semiconductor systems.
August 06, 2025
Facebook X Reddit
Firmware signing and verification chains form the backbone of secure semiconductor platforms by ensuring that only authenticated, approved software can be installed and executed. At the core of this model is a hierarchy of cryptographic keys and certificates that validate integrity from the moment a device powers on. Developers sign firmware images with private keys, while hardware enforces the corresponding public keys during the boot sequence. Any attempt to modify the firmware would produce a signature mismatch, instantly halting the boot process. This approach creates a robust defense against tampering, reproduction, or substitution of critical system software, and it provides a traceable audit trail for compliance and forensics.
A well-designed signing and verification chain relies on multiple layers of defense to deter different classes of attacker. First, secure provisioning ensures private keys are created and stored in tamper-resistant elements, never exposed in plaintext. Second, protected boot verifies that each stage of the startup process is authorized by cryptographic checks before handing control to the next stage. Third, update mechanisms deliver new firmware only through authenticated channels, which often include encryption and attestation guarantees. Together, these layers minimize the risk of lineage breakages where a compromised image could bypass security checks, and they improve resilience against supply chain threats by binding code to a hardware-backed identity.
Protecting update channels and provenance to deter supply chain risks.
In practice, the first layer of defense is the immutable root of trust that hardware provides. A hardware security module or secure enclave stores root keys within a protected boundary, inaccessible to firmware running in normal mode. During boot, the firmware checks signatures against this root and rejects anything unsigned or incorrectly signed. This immutable trust anchor prevents attackers from injecting forged images at the earliest possible moment. The decision to trust or deny is made deterministically, ensuring repeatable outcomes across devices and firmware revisions. As a result, even sophisticated attacks struggle to impersonate legitimate software or to override critical boot decisions.
ADVERTISEMENT
ADVERTISEMENT
Beyond the root of trust, a chain of trust extends through each stage of the firmware stack. Each component—preloader, bootloader, kernel, and management agents—carries its own signature and verifier. The bootloader enforces the policy that only components signed with approved keys may execute. If any link in the chain fails validation, execution is halted, and the system may enter a safe recovery mode. This approach prevents dangerous escalation paths where an attacker tampers with a later stage to hide earlier compromises. It also enables granular controls over which updates are acceptable in production environments, further limiting exposure to rogue code.
Layered defenses pair cryptographic guarantees with policy-driven controls.
Secure updates begin with provenance, ensuring every firmware artifact can be traced to a trusted source. Signatures bind a specific build to a developer or vendor identity, and metadata records document the release date, version, and intended devices. The update mechanism must enforce integrity checks even when the update package traverses untrusted networks. Encrypted transport, code signing, and strict replay protection guard against man-in-the-middle tampering, stale packages, or rollback attacks. When a device receives an update, its verification logic checks both the cryptographic signature and the update’s lineage, ensuring that only validated changes are applied.
ADVERTISEMENT
ADVERTISEMENT
Some platforms adopt attestation features that prove a device’s firmware state to remote evaluators. Remote attestation can reveal whether the boot chain, local configuration, and security policies are intact without exposing sensitive keys. This capability supports supply chain security by allowing enterprises to verify fleets of devices before deployment or during ongoing operation. Attestation typically involves a challenge-response protocol where the device signs measurements of its current state with a private key. Verifiers compare these measurements against a trusted baseline, enabling rapid remediation if integrity is compromised. This transparency strengthens trust in the entire ecosystem.
Real-world deployment requires careful integration and ongoing stewardship.
Policy enforcement complements cryptography by translating technical guarantees into actionable rules. Admins establish what firmware versions are permissible, how often devices may be updated, and under which conditions unattended maintenance is allowed. Policy engines can reject firmware packages that lack a valid signature, fail to meet minimum security baselines, or originate from untrusted supply chains. In practice, these policies reduce the attack surface by shortening the window of opportunity for attackers to exploit outdated code. They also standardize security practices across device families, improving maintainability and reducing operational risk.
The human factor remains critical; robust processes for key management and incident response are essential. Key rotation schedules, access controls, and empty-key backstops limit the damage that could occur if credentials are compromised. Regular security reviews, independent audits, and simulated breach exercises help ensure that signing and verification mechanisms function under pressure. When incidents arise, clear runbooks guide developers and operators through containment, recovery, and forensic activities. By combining cryptographic protections with disciplined governance, organizations can sustain strong defenses against evolving threats.
ADVERTISEMENT
ADVERTISEMENT
The future of secure firmware lies in automation and continuous trust.
Implementers face practical challenges in balancing security with performance and usability. Firmware signing introduces some latency during boot and update processes, but the payoff is significantly reduced risk of persistent compromise. Efficient cryptographic libraries and streamlined verification paths minimize overhead in resource-constrained semiconductor environments. Design teams must also consider secure storage, liveliness checks, and side-channel resistance to guard against leaking keys or leaking sensitive state. Ongoing maintenance—such as renewing certificates and updating trusted roots—requires careful scheduling so the system remains secure without interrupting critical operations.
Collaboration across the supply chain is vital for end-to-end security. Chip manufacturers, firmware developers, and platform integrators must align on key lifecycles, certificate authorities, and attestation standards. Transparent documentation and interoperable verification protocols help ensure that each stakeholder can independently validate the integrity of firmware at every stage. When everyone adheres to common signing conventions and verification criteria, the overall ecosystem becomes more resilient to counterfeit code, misissued updates, and malicious substitutions that could otherwise go undetected until after deployment.
Automation accelerates the deployment of verified firmware while maintaining rigorous controls. Continuous integration pipelines can automatically sign builds, verify dependencies, and generate attestation data for each release. Telemetry and monitoring tools observe boot integrity in real time, flagging deviations promptly. Machine-readable policies enable adaptive defense, where systems respond to detected anomalies by isolating components or rolling back to known-good configurations. As silicon complexity grows, automated verification must scale accordingly, offering modular verifications that can adapt to new architectures without compromising established protections.
Looking ahead, manufacturers are increasingly embedding stronger cryptographic hardware, smarter key management, and auditable provenance into device lifecycles. This trend reduces attack windows and makes unauthorized code execution far less likely. By integrating signing and verification into the earliest moments of boot and throughout every software update, semiconductor platforms can maintain secure operations across diverse environments. Even as attackers attempt to exploit supply chain gaps, robust signing chains—tied to hardware roots and policy controls—deliver a durable guarantee: trusted software executes only as intended, on devices that remain shielded from tampering and impersonation.
Related Articles
In modern integrated circuits, strategic power-aware placement mitigates IR drop hotspots by balancing current paths, optimizing routing, and stabilizing supply rails, thereby enhancing reliability, performance, and manufacturability across diverse operating conditions.
August 09, 2025
Clear, reliable documentation and disciplined configuration management create resilient workflows, reducing human error, enabling rapid recovery, and maintaining high yields through intricate semiconductor fabrication sequences and evolving equipment ecosystems.
August 08, 2025
Thoughtful pad and bond pad design minimizes mechanical stress pathways, improving die attachment reliability by distributing strain, accommodating thermal cycles, and reducing crack initiation at critical interfaces, thereby extending device lifetimes and safeguarding performance in demanding environments.
July 28, 2025
This article explores how cutting-edge thermal adhesives and gap fillers enhance electrical and thermal conduction at critical interfaces, enabling faster, cooler, and more reliable semiconductor performance across diverse device architectures.
July 29, 2025
A comprehensive exploration of secure boot chain design, outlining robust strategies, verification, hardware-software co-design, trusted execution environments, and lifecycle management to protect semiconductor platform controllers against evolving threats.
July 29, 2025
This evergreen guide explores practical architectures, data strategies, and evaluation methods for monitoring semiconductor equipment, revealing how anomaly detection enables proactive maintenance, reduces downtime, and extends the life of core manufacturing assets.
July 22, 2025
Co-optimization of lithography and layout represents a strategic shift in chip fabrication, aligning design intent with process realities to reduce defects, improve pattern fidelity, and unlock higher yields at advanced nodes through integrated simulation, layout-aware lithography, and iterative feedback between design and manufacturing teams.
July 21, 2025
A comprehensive, evergreen overview of practical methods to reduce phase noise in semiconductor clock circuits, exploring design, materials, and system-level strategies that endure across technologies and applications.
July 19, 2025
standardized testing and validation frameworks create objective benchmarks, enabling transparent comparisons of performance, reliability, and manufacturing quality among competing semiconductor products and suppliers across diverse operating conditions.
July 29, 2025
This evergreen guide explores robust methods for choosing wafer probing test patterns, emphasizing defect visibility, fault coverage, pattern diversity, and practical measurement strategies that endure across process nodes and device families.
August 12, 2025
This evergreen exploration surveys design strategies, material choices, and packaging techniques for chip-scale inductors and passive components, highlighting practical paths to higher efficiency, reduced parasitics, and resilient performance in power conversion within compact semiconductor packages.
July 30, 2025
Electrochemical migration is a subtle, time-dependent threat to metal lines in microelectronics. By applying targeted mitigation strategies—material selection, barrier engineering, and operating-condition controls—manufacturers extend device lifetimes and preserve signal integrity against corrosion-driven failure.
August 09, 2025
Predictive process models transform qualification by simulating operations, forecasting performance, and guiding experimental focus. They minimize risk, accelerate learning cycles, and reduce costly iterations during node and material qualification in modern fabrication facilities.
July 18, 2025
In sectors relying on outsourced fabrication, establishing durable acceptance criteria for process steps and deliverables is essential to ensure product reliability, supply chain resilience, and measurable performance across diverse environments and manufacturing partners.
July 18, 2025
This evergreen article examines proven arbitration strategies that prevent starvation and deadlocks, focusing on fairness, efficiency, and scalability in diverse semiconductor interconnect ecosystems and evolving multi-core systems.
August 11, 2025
A practical exploration of stacking strategies in advanced multi-die packages, detailing methods to balance heat, strain, and electrical performance, with guidance on selecting materials, layouts, and assembly processes for robust, scalable semiconductor systems.
July 30, 2025
Effective integration of diverse memory technologies requires strategies that optimize latency, maximize bandwidth, and preserve data across power cycles, while maintaining cost efficiency, scalability, and reliability in modern semiconductor architectures.
July 30, 2025
Secure provisioning workflows during semiconductor manufacturing fortify cryptographic material integrity by reducing supply chain exposure, enforcing robust authentication, and enabling verifiable provenance while mitigating insider threats and hardware tampering across global fabrication ecosystems.
July 16, 2025
A practical exploration of architectural patterns, trust boundaries, and verification practices that enable robust, scalable secure virtualization on modern semiconductor platforms, addressing performance, isolation, and lifecycle security considerations for diverse workloads.
July 30, 2025
In modern semiconductor fabs, crafting balanced process control strategies demands integrating statistical rigor, cross-functional collaboration, and adaptive monitoring to secure high yield while preserving the electrical and physical integrity of advanced devices.
August 10, 2025